Thermal Detection with FLIR: Applications and Benefits

FLIR devices leverage the power of infrared technology to detect variations in heat signatures. These heat-seeking images reveal temperature differences that are invisible to the human eye, providing valuable insights in a wide range of applications. From monitoring industrial equipment for overheating issues to identifying hidden leaks in buildings, FLIR technology offers numerous benefits.

By detecting temperature, FLIR systems can help improve performance and reduce maintenance costs.

  • Some common applications for FLIR include:
  • Search and rescue operations|Law enforcement activities|Building inspections
  • Industrial process control|Firefighting|Medical diagnostics

The non-invasive nature of thermal detection makes FLIR technology ideal for situations where physical access is limited or hazardous. Additionally, FLIR systems often provide real-time data, allowing for prompt decision-making and improved situational awareness.

Choosing the Right FLIR Camera for Your Needs

With a plethora of FLIR cameras available on the market, selecting the right one for your particular needs can be tricky. First, figure out the primary application for your camera. Are you using it for commercial inspections, research, or another purpose? Once you understand your application, evaluate the characteristics that are greatest.

Some crucial factors include resolution, thermal sensitivity, field of view, and connectivity options. It's also beneficial to ponder the circumstances in which you'll be using the camera. If you're working in a harsh environment, look a camera with durable construction and weatherproofing.

Finally, don't forget to determine a budget. FLIR cameras come in a vast range of prices, so it's crucial to find one that aligns with your financial limitations. By carefully considering these factors, you can choose the right FLIR camera for your needs and get the greatest value for your investment.
